Scrapping scheme in England 

A scrapping scheme has also been introduced in England. The Taxi testifies on the pictures. Who would have thought that a time would come in England when everything would no longer be kept?

More than twenty years ago this was unimaginable and now it is even the case that the older cars do not automatically get an exemption for road tax and MOT. In England the border is fixed and not like ours for all cars older than 25 to 30 years. That is where the boundary was laid for the 1973 year. All cars registered after 1 1 1973 have a breakdown. When you drive around England now you see just as few classic vehicles on the road as with us.
